Home
last modified time | relevance | path

Searched refs:clip2tri (Results 1 – 12 of 12) sorted by relevance

/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/3rdparty/clip2tri/
H A Dclip2tri.cpp63 clip2tri::clip2tri() : openSubject(false) in clip2tri() function in c2t::clip2tri
68 clip2tri::~clip2tri() in ~clip2tri()
74 void clip2tri::triangulate(const vector<vector<Point> > &inputPolygons, vector<Point> &outputTriang… in triangulate()
87 void clip2tri::addClipPolygon(const Path &path) in addClipPolygon()
99 void clip2tri::addSubjectPath(const Path &path, bool closed) in addSubjectPath()
114 void clip2tri::clearClipper() in clearClipper()
121 static QtClipperLib::ClipType operation(const clip2tri::Operation &op) in operation()
124 case clip2tri::Intersection: in operation()
126 case clip2tri::Union: in operation()
128 case clip2tri::Difference: in operation()
[all …]
H A Dclip2tri.h60 class clip2tri
77 clip2tri();
78 virtual ~clip2tri();
H A Dclip2tri.pro18 HEADERS += clip2tri.h
19 SOURCES += clip2tri.cpp
/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/
H A Dsrc.pro7 clip2tri.subdir = 3rdparty/clip2tri
11 SUBDIRS += clip2tri clipper poly2tri
12 clip2tri.depends = clipper poly2tri
15 positioning.depends = clip2tri
20 location.depends += positioningquick clip2tri
/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/location/declarativemaps/
H A Dqdeclarativegeomapitemutils.cpp137 c2t::clip2tri clipper; in clipPolygon()
140 …Paths res = clipper.execute(c2t::clip2tri::Intersection, QtClipperLib::pftEvenOdd, QtClipperLib::p… in clipPolygon()
H A Dqdeclarativecirclemapitem.cpp192 c2t::clip2tri clipper; in updateScreenPointsInvert()
195 …Paths difference = clipper.execute(c2t::clip2tri::Difference, QtClipperLib::pftEvenOdd, QtClipperL… in updateScreenPointsInvert()
206 …Paths res = clipper.execute(c2t::clip2tri::Intersection, QtClipperLib::pftEvenOdd, QtClipperLib::p… in updateScreenPointsInvert()
H A Dqdeclarativepolygonmapitem.cpp212 c2t::clip2tri clipper; in updateSourcePoints()
215 …Paths res = clipper.execute(c2t::clip2tri::Intersection, QtClipperLib::pftEvenOdd, QtClipperLib::p… in updateSourcePoints()
H A Dqdeclarativepolylinemapitem.cpp181 …const int firstContained = c2t::clip2tri::pointInPolygon(toIntPoint(l.at(i).x(), l.at(i).y()), cli… in clipLine()
182 …const int secondContained = c2t::clip2tri::pointInPolygon(toIntPoint(l.at(i+1).x(), l.at(i+1).y())… in clipLine()
/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/location/maps/
H A Dqgeoprojection.cpp773 c2t::clip2tri clipper; in updateVisibleRegion()
778 Paths res = clipper.execute(c2t::clip2tri::Intersection); in updateVisibleRegion()
817 c2t::clip2tri clipperProjectable; in updateVisibleRegion()
822 Paths resProjectable = clipperProjectable.execute(c2t::clip2tri::Intersection); in updateVisibleRegion()
841 c2t::clip2tri clipperExpanded; in updateVisibleRegion()
845 Paths resVisibleExpanded = clipperExpanded.execute(c2t::clip2tri::Intersection); in updateVisibleRegion()
/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/location/
H A Dlocation.pro17 INCLUDEPATH += ../3rdparty/clip2tri
/OK3568_Linux_fs/buildroot/dl/qt5location/git/src/positioning/
H A Dpositioning.pro7 INCLUDEPATH += ../3rdparty/clip2tri
H A Dqgeopolygon.cpp618 if (!c2t::clip2tri::pointInPolygon(intCoord, m_clipperPath)) in polygonContains()